Transaction 62f8e4eab543428bf90aa70d91ff027e5d928c809a0899bc78e14acf702782ba

2 Input
2 Outputs
  • 62f8e4eab543428bf90aa70d91ff027e5d928c809a0899bc78e14acf702782ba:0
  • value  5364300
    address  1DKENaugKjyrPJSieLHxDQD5Q8yaycf7gw
  • 62f8e4eab543428bf90aa70d91ff027e5d928c809a0899bc78e14acf702782ba:1
  • value  38835744
    address  3GfdBTZ2w7Pk8HnrydcMQ6ACPTvc9eAuJf